Leo says that the product n x 4/5 is greater than 4/5 because multiplication always increases a number. Which of the following values for n shown that Leo is incorrect?

a. 2
b. 7/6
c. 5/8
d. 5/4
e. 6/6

Answer: Let's plug in each value for n and compare the results:

a. n = 2

2 x 4/5 = 8/5 which is greater than 4/5.

b. n = 7/6

7/6 x 4/5 = 28/30 which simplifies to 14/15 which is greater than 4/5.

c. n = 5/8

5/8 x 4/5 = 20/40 which simplifies to 1/2 which is less than 4/5.

d. n = 5/4

5/4 x 4/5 = 20/20 which simplifies to 1 which is greater than 4/5.

e. n = 6/6

6/6 x 4/5 = 24/30 which simplifies to 4/5.

Therefore, the answer is (c) 5/8, which shows that Leo is incorrect. In this case, the product is less than 4/5.
